        History

        Sir Thomas Edward Colebrooke, known as Sir Edward Colebrooke, was the second son of Henry Thomas Colebrooke, founder of the RAS. Alongside leading a political career, he served as the President of the Society from 1864 to 1866, from 1875 to 1877 and in 1881.
